1.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
Projeto Liowsn: Um sistema operacional para
estudos com simulações de RSSF.
Marllus de Melo Lustosa
2.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
Sumário:
1. O que é uma Rede de Sensores Sem Fio (RSSF)
1.1. Estrutura de um RSSF
1.2. Por que estudar esse tema?
1.3. Características essenciais
2. Avaliação de desempenho em RSSF
2.1. Simulação
2.2. Por que simular em RSSF?
2.3. Dificuldades
3. Projeto Liowsn = Linux for Works with WSN
3.1. Objetivos
3.2. Metodologia de execução
3.3. Simuladores na literatura
3.4. Arquitetura
3.5. Projeto Liowsn em funcionamento
3.6. Resultados
4. Trabalhos futuros
5. Colaboradores
Marllus de Melo Lustosa
3.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
1. O que é uma Rede de Sensores Sem Fio?
Alguns pesquisadores têm mostrado ser possível
integrar
sensores
(acústicos, infravermelho, câmera, temperatura, calor, sí
smico, etc), comunicação e fonte de alimentação em
dispositivos miniaturizados usando apenas tecnologia
de circuitos digitais, comunicação sem fio e sistemas
micro-eletromecânicos, de maneira a fundar uma nova
tecnologia na área de redes ad hoc que tem sido
chamada de WSN (Wireless Sensor Networks - Rede de
Sensores Sem Fio) [Estrin99] ou sistemas Smart Dust
[Kahn99]. A ideia é tirar proveito de dispositivos tão
pequenos e baratos que possam ser usados em tão
larga escala que viabilizem aplicações até então
Marllus de Melo Lustosa
4.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
1. O que é uma Rede de Sensores Sem Fio?
- Objetivo
de
monitorar
algum
fenômeno.
- Composta por três partes: o sensor, o fenômeno e o
observador.
- Sensor: Monitora o fenômeno que esta sendo analisado.
- Fenômeno: Grandeza analógica.
- Observador: Usuário final que estuda o fenômeno.
- Aplicação em locais de difícil acesso.
Marllus de Melo Lustosa
5.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
1.1. Estrutura de uma RSSF
Sink
Observador
Marllus de Melo Lustosa
6.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
1.1. Estrutura de uma RSSF
Sink
Observador
Marllus de Melo Lustosa
7.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
1.3. Por que estudar esse tema?
Marllus de Melo Lustosa
8.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
1.4. Características essenciais
- Alteração na topologia de rede pelas condições dinâmicas do
ambiente e pelas possíveis falhas dos sensores.
- Limitação do sensor em processamento, memória e energia.
- Uso de comunicação broadcast, podendo haver colisões e
congestionamentos.
- Uso do meio sem fio (wireless), com considerável taxa de erro.
Marllus de Melo Lustosa
9.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
2. Avaliação de desempenho em RSSF
Modelagem analítica
Medição real
Simulação
Marllus de Melo Lustosa
10.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
2.1. Simulação
“A simulação é um processo de projetar um modelo
computacional de um sistema real e conduzir experimentos
com este modelo com o propósito de entender seu
comportamento e/ou avaliar estratégias para sua operação”
Pegden (1990)
Marllus de Melo Lustosa
11.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
2.2. Por que simular em RSSF?
- Possibilita a modelagem de fontes de tráfego.
- Facilita a implementação do projeto, além de poder comparar
modelos
de
protocolos
a
serem
utilizados.
- Possibilita a análise de desempenho
parâmetros e tempos de observação.
com
diferentes
- Média de pacotes recebidos/enviados pelos sensores.
- A energia consumida na rede, em determinado intervalo de
tempo.
- Tempo de vida dos nós sensores.
Marllus de Melo Lustosa
12.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
2.3. Dificuldades encontradas
- Ambiente GNU/Linux – Terminal. [Nabble][The Mail Archive]
- Dificuldades na instalação dos programas (dependências).
- Dificuldade na implantação de módulos para RSSF (NS-2).
- Falta de corpo técnico para configuração e manutenção.
- Falta de atualização das ferramentas, por parte dos seus
desenvolvedores.
Marllus de Melo Lustosa
13.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3. Projeto Liowsn = Linux for Works with WSN
Propor um sistema operacional remasterizado para trabalhos
com simulações de redes de sensores sem fio.
Marllus de Melo Lustosa
14.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3.1. Objetivos
- Reunir várias ferramentas da literatura, instalá-las e configurálas em um só sistema operacional.
- Auxiliar pesquisadores e profissionais na implantação do
ambiente de simulação para os trabalhos computacionais com
RSSF.
- Diminuir o “enorme” tempo gasto no processo de
instalação e configuração dessas ferramentas.
Marllus de Melo Lustosa
15.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3.2. Metodologia de execução
Busca
das
dificuldades
preparação de ambientes
simulação.
na
de
Remasterização
do
sistema
operacional,
por
meio
do
programa Remastersys.
Instalação
e
configuração,
ferramentas e módulos, em
operacional GNU/Linux.
Marllus de Melo Lustosa
destas
sistema
16.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3.3. Simuladores na literatura [Marllus, 2012]
Marllus de Melo Lustosa
17.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3.4. Arquitetura
user
tools
GNU/Linux
Ubuntu 9.10
Marllus de Melo Lustosa
Liowsn
Project
18.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3.5. Projeto Liowsn em funcionamento
Marllus de Melo Lustosa
19.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3.5. Projeto Liowsn em funcionamento
Marllus de Melo Lustosa
20.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3.6. Resultados
-
Downloads: 335
33 países (Total) - Top country: India (38% de downloads)
– Brasil
- Vietnam - Ucrânia
- África do Sul
- Índia
- França
- Marrocos - Malásia
- Itália
- Bangladesh
- Sudão
- Ruanda
- China
- Iraque
- Arábia Saudita
- Birmânia
- Egito
- Dinamarca
- Bélgica
- Letônia
- EUA
- Tailândia - Indonésia - Emirados Árabes
- Paquistão
- Canadá
- Portugal - Argélia
Marllus de Melo Lustosa
21.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3.6. Resultados
Comentários:
http://freesystemadministrationsofwere.blogspot.com.br/
“Liowsn Project is currently much sought after and are a favorite
software the in world.”
http://softwaregeek.com/
“Liowsn Project is the best freeware operating system for works with
WSN”
Marllus de Melo Lustosa
22.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3.6. Resultados
Publicações e palestras:
M. Lustosa. “O Projeto Liowsn”. (Página 60-62 edição 39). ISSN 2236031X. Revista
Espírito Livre. revista.espiritolivre.org. Junho 2012.
M. Lustosa, S. Singh. “Liowsn Project: An Operating System Remastered for
Works with Simulation of Wireless Sensor Networks”. (Volume 52 – No.12).
International Journal of Computer Applications (IJCA). August 2012.
Software Freedom Day 2012: Palestra com tema “Projeto Liowsn: Um sistema
operacional para trabalhos com Redes de Sensores Sem Fio”.
http://softwarelivre.org/sfd-teresina/
Marllus de Melo Lustosa
23.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
3.6. Resultados
Papers: Utilization and citation
Reena, R. Pandit, V. Richariya. “Performance Evaluation of Routing Protocols for
Manet using NS2”. (Volume 66 – No.24). International Journal of Computer
Applications (IJCA). March 2013.
R. G. Balaji, P. S. Raghavendran, R. Ashokan. “Performances Enhancement in
Wireless Body Area Network (WBAN)”. (Volume 3 - Issue 2). International Journal
of Engineering and Innovative Technology (IJEIT). August 2013
Qualis Capes: A2
B. K. Saha, S. Misra, M. S. Obaidat. “A web-based integrated environment for
simulation and analysis with NS-2”. DOI 10.1109/MWC.2013.6590057. Wireless
Communications, IEEE (Volume: 20 , Issue: 4). August 2013.
Marllus de Melo Lustosa
24.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
4. Trabalhos futuros
- A partir do Kernel Linux, recriar um S.O.
- Adicionar mais ferramentas disponíveis na literatura.
- Otimizar o sistema, com foco em pesquisas com RSSF.
- Desenvolver um front-end (na web e/ou desktop) que facilite
a criação de topologias e cenários para RSSF.
Marllus de Melo Lustosa
25.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
5. Colaboradores
Laboratório de Sistemas
Onipresentes e Pervasivos –
OPALA – UESPI
Marllus de Melo Lustosa
Shivjay Tomar Singh
Jiwaji University
Gwalior - India
26.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
Referências
Estrin. "Scalable Coordination in sensor Networks", D. Estrin, R. Govindan, J. Heidemann, USC/Information
Sciences Institute, //www.lecs.cs.ucla.edu/~estrin/,1999
Kahn. "Emerging Challenges Mobile Networking for "Smart Dust"", J. M. Kahn, R. H. Katz, K. S. Pister, EECS,
U. C. Berkeley, //www.eecs.berkeley.edu/~jmk/,1999
Pegden, C.D. et al. Introduction to simulation using SIMAN. NY: McGraw-Hill, 2nd ed, 1990.
Nabble. 2012. Network Simulator ns-2 - The Official Discussion List. Research on errors in the installation of
the ns- 2.http://old.nabble.com/forum/Search.jtp?query=installati
on+error+ns&local=y&forum=15582&daterange=0&star tdate=&enddate=/
The Mail Archive. 2012. Discussion list of the ns-users. Research on errors in the installation of modules on
the ns-2. http://www.mailarchive.com/search?l=ns-users%40isi.edu&q=error+installation+module.
L., Marllus. ”Introdução à simulação de redes de computadores com o NS-2 (Network Simulator) – Teoria e
Prática. Capítulo de livro. Nº 1. ENUCOMP 2012.”
Marllus de Melo Lustosa
27. Departamento de Computação - DC
Bacharelado em Ciência da Computação - UFPI
Página do projeto
http://sourceforge.net/projects/liowsn/
Contatos
www.marllus.com
@marllusmelo
marlluslustosa@gmail.com
Marllus de Melo Lustosa